viernes, 12 de diciembre de 2025

Genact: El Secreto para Parecer un Hacker Ocupado (y por qué lo necesitas)


Introducción: La Magia de la Terminal Falsa

¿Alguna vez has estado en una videollamada o una presentación y has querido darle un toque dramático a tu terminal? Tal vez solo quieres que tu jefe piense que estás compilando el código fuente del universo. ¡Para eso existe Genact!

Genact (abreviatura de Generic Activity) es un generador de actividad falso y minimalista para tu terminal. No hace nada útil, pero simula perfectamente procesos como la compilación de código, el descifrado de contraseñas, la instalación de paquetes o el ataque a un servidor. Es pura diversión y una excelente herramienta para una broma inofensiva.

Si quieres impresionar o simplemente reírte un rato, aquí te explicamos cómo instalarlo y ponerlo en marcha.

Guía de Instalación Rápida para Linux/macOS

Dado que genact es un binario simple escrito en Rust, la forma más fácil de instalarlo es descargando el ejecutable directamente desde su repositorio de GitHub y poniéndolo en un lugar accesible, como ~/bin.

Ejecuta el siguiente script en tu terminal. Nota importante: Estamos utilizando la URL de la última versión. Si GitHub cambia el nombre exacto del archivo binario (genact-linux), quizás debas revisar la página de releases y cambiar la URL.

El Script de Instalación

Copia y pega las siguientes cuatro líneas en tu terminal y presiona Enter:

# 1. Creamos la carpeta de ejecutables personales si no existe
mkdir -p ~/bin

# 2. Descargamos el binario para Linux/macOS directamente
curl -L [https://github.com/svenstaro/genact/releases/latest/download/genact-linux](https://github.com/svenstaro/genact/releases/latest/download/genact-linux) -o ~/bin/genact

# 3. Le damos permisos de ejecución al archivo descargado
chmod +x ~/bin/genact

# 4. (Opcional) Ejecutamos una prueba de compilación
~/bin/genact compile

¿Qué hace cada línea?

  1. mkdir -p ~/bin: Crea la carpeta bin dentro de tu directorio personal (~) si aún no existe. La bandera -p asegura que no haya error si ya existe.

  2. curl -L ... -o ~/bin/genact: Usa curl para descargar el archivo ejecutable (genact-linux) desde la última release de GitHub y lo guarda con el nombre simple genact en tu carpeta ~/bin.

  3. chmod +x ~/bin/genact: Asigna el permiso de ejecución (+x) para que el sistema pueda correr el archivo como un programa.

  4. ~/bin/genact compile: Ejecuta el programa y le pide que inicie el modo de "Compilación". ¡Mira cómo la magia sucede en tu pantalla!

Hora de la Acción: ¡Modos de Uso!

Una vez que el binario genact está en tu carpeta ~/bin, puedes ejecutarlo directamente desde cualquier lugar si esa carpeta está incluida en tu $PATH (lo cual es común).

Aquí hay algunos de los modos más populares que puedes probar:

Comando

Simulación

Objetivo

genact compile

Compilación de un proyecto

Parecer que estás construyendo una aplicación compleja.

genact download

Descarga de paquetes

Simula una descarga rápida de archivos grandes.

genact mining

Minería de criptomonedas

Muestra estadísticas de un proceso de minería.

genact memstress

Pruebas de memoria

Simula un estrés o test de memoria en el sistema.

genact modules

Carga de módulos

Parece que el kernel está cargando librerías.

genact decompile

Descompilación de código

¡El modo perfecto para un verdadero hacker!

Para ver una lista completa de todos los modos disponibles, simplemente escribe:

genact --help

¡Ahora ya estás listo para simular cualquier actividad de terminal que desees!

No hay comentarios:

Publicar un comentario